Skype- A Simple way to Transform Learning with Technology

1/15/2015

15 Comments

 
Picture
2nd grade students at Martin City Elementary participated in a Skype session with author Cindy Lou Aillaud, writer of the book Recess at 20 below.  Students took turns reading portions of the book to Ms. Aillaud and then asked her questions about life in Alaska.

Skype sessions like this are becoming more and more common in the district as teachers realize the potential of such activities. Later this week 1st grade students at Belvidere will be Skyping with a scientist. If you are interested in the potential for using Skype in your classroom, you should check out the Skype in the Classroom website. Don't know where to start?
